Dr John Connelly

GP

Dr Connelly qualified from University College Dublin. He has been working in general practice for more than 20 years.

 

He is qualified as a specialist in general practice and is on the specialist register of the medical council.

He is a member of the Irish College of General Practitioners.

He is a trainer of undergraduate medical students from Trinity College and the Royal College of Surgeons in Ireland.

He is also training the next generation of general practitioners as a GP trainer in the north east region.

 

Dr Connelly has additional qualifications in musculoskeletal medicine, occupational medicine and aviation medicine.

 

He also works as a medical assessor at the Irish Aviation Authority, contributing to the assurance that pilots and aircrew are fit to fly.

 

He has a special interest in mens and womens health (in particular menopause) and provides a wide range of contraception services (including Implanon insertion)
